Why These Are the Top Chevrolet Repair Auto Repair Shops in Sabine Pass

** The Chevrolet repair market serving Sabine Pass is characterized by a small number of high-quality, independent shops located in the neighboring cities of Port Arthur and Groves. There is a notable absence of large, corporate chains or a dedicated Chevrolet/Cadillac dealership in the immediate area, which has fostered a competitive environment among these local independents. The average quality of service is high, as these businesses rely heavily on community reputation and long-term customer relationships. Competition is strong but professional, focusing on technical expertise and customer service rather than price undercutting. Typical pricing is in line with regional averages for Southeast Texas, with diagnostic fees ranging from $100-$150 and labor rates between $90-$130 per hour. These shops are accustomed to servicing vehicles common in a coastal and industrial region, including Chevrolet trucks and SUVs used for both personal and light commercial purposes. For highly specialized Corvette or performance tuning work, residents may need to travel to the larger Beaumont market.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about chevrolet repair services in Sabine Pass, TX

What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ues for drivers in Sabine Pass, TX, due to local conditions?

The coastal, humid environment in Sabine Pass commonly leads to accelerated corrosion and rust on undercarriages and brake components. Additionally, frequent short trips and stop-and-go driving on local roads can cause increased wear on batteries, starters, and the transmission in Chevrolet models.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Chevrolet repair shop in or near Sabine Pass?

Given Sabine Pass's smaller size, you may need to look at shops in nearby Port Arthur, but always seek out ASE-certified technicians with specific Chevrolet or GM experience. Check for online reviews from other local drivers and ask if the shop uses genuine GM parts or high-quality alternatives for repairs.

Are repair costs for Chevrolets higher in Sabine Pass compared to larger cities?

Labor rates can be competitive, but parts availability might sometimes cause slight delays or variations in cost due to the need for sourcing from larger distributors. It's always wise to get a detailed written estimate upfront, as specialized repairs for newer Chevrolet models may require a trip to a dealership in Beaumont or Lake Charles.

When should I seek immediate service for my Chevrolet if I frequently drive on Sabine Pass roads or near the industrial areas?

Seek immediate service if you notice any steering issues or unusual noises from the suspension, as potholes and heavy industrial truck traffic can damage components. Also, address any warning lights like the Check Engine light promptly, as coastal air can affect sensors and emissions systems.

What local factor should I consider when scheduling routine maintenance for my Chevrolet in Sabine Pass?

The high humidity and salt air necessitate more frequent attention to your vehicle's exterior and undercarriage to prevent rust. It's also wise to schedule AC system checks before the intense summer heat and humidity arrive, as the system works harder in our climate.
